According to Stratistics MRC, the Global Online Coding Bootcamps Market is accounted for $738.2 million in 2025 and is expected to reach $2036.5 million by 2032 growing at a CAGR of 15.6% during the forecast period. Online coding bootcamps provide intensive, short-term training programs in software development, web development, data science, and other tech skills through digital platforms. This market is driven by demand for rapid skill acquisition, career switching, and upskilling in IT. Courses often include project-based learning, mentorship, and career support. Growth is fueled by increasing digitalization, talent shortages, and flexible learning preferences. Market players differentiate through curriculum depth, placement assistance, and interactive learning experiences for professionals and students seeking employable tech skills.
According to Amazon, its Upskilling 2025 initiative allocates $1.2 billion to train 300,000 employees in tech skills, including coding bootcamps.
Demand for tech professionals
Employers across industries seek job-ready developers with practical skills, and bootcamps deliver focused, project-based training that accelerates workforce entry. Furthermore, shorter course durations and curriculum alignment with employer needs increase appeal for career changers and recent graduates. Additionally, strong hiring outcomes and employer partnerships reinforce perceived value, prompting more learners to prefer bootcamps over traditional degrees. This sustained demand supports market expansion, encourages new program offerings, and attracts investment into platform enhancements and instructor talent.
Lack of accreditation
Lack of formal accreditation remains a significant restraint for the online coding bootcamps market, limiting recognition by employers and academic institutions. Without standardized credentials, some organizations hesitate to equate bootcamp certificates with traditional degrees, restricting graduate hiring and progression into higher education. Moreover, inconsistent quality across providers creates confusion for prospective students evaluating return on investment. Consequently, the market faces pressure to develop quality-assurance frameworks, industry-recognized standards, and transparent outcome reporting to build greater trust among employers, regulators, learners, and other stakeholders. Such reforms are essential for sustained sector growth.
Partnerships with tech companies
Partnerships with tech companies present a clear opportunity to enhance the value proposition of online coding bootcamps by aligning curricula with real-world employer needs. Collaborations enable co-designed modules, guest instructors, project briefs sourced from industry, and direct recruitment pipelines, which improve graduate employability. Additionally, corporate sponsorships and apprenticeship pathways reduce cost barriers for learners and provide revenue streams for providers. Such alliances also accelerate curriculum updates to keep pace with fast-evolving technologies, positioning bootcamps as a practical, industry-integrated alternative to traditional education and driving market expansion, and deepen employer trust.
Intense competition
Intense competition is a material threat to the online coding bootcamps market, as numerous for-profit and non-profit providers vie for students, employer partnerships, and instructional talent. Price wars, aggressive marketing, and rapid program launches can compress margins and lead to variable quality as providers scale quickly. Moreover, competition from universities offering accelerated, industry-aligned certificates and free online resources increases substitution risks. Consequently, smaller or lower-quality providers may struggle to differentiate; prompting consolidation, increased customer acquisition costs, and pressure to continuously demonstrate superior learning outcomes while regulatory scrutiny may intensify significantly.
Covid-19 accelerated adoption of online learning and served as a catalyst for growth in the online coding bootcamps market. Lockdowns and hiring freezes initially disrupted placements, but remote hiring practices and digital transformation across sectors increased demand for technical talent. Furthermore, learners shifted from in-person to virtual formats, prompting providers to enhance remote pedagogy, mentorship, and assessment tools. Overall, the pandemic compressed traditional timelines for digital adoption and permanently expanded the market addressable audience.
The full-time bootcamps segment is expected to be the largest during the forecast period
The full-time bootcamps segment is expected to account for the largest market share during the forecast period. Full-time bootcamps attract learners seeking rapid career transitions through immersive schedules, structured mentorship, and intensive project work that mirrors workplace demands. Employers prefer graduates from concentrated, hands-on programs because they demonstrate practical proficiency and onboard faster. Higher placement rates and dedicated career services such as interview preparation increase perceived value despite higher upfront cost. Cohort-based learning also boosts completion and peer accountability. These factors explain why full-time formats command the largest market share and maintain strong, sustained demand from both learners and hiring firms consistently.
The cybersecurity segment is expected to have the highest CAGR during the forecast period
Over the forecast period, the cybersecurity segment is predicted to witness the highest growth rate. Demand for cybersecurity skills is rising as organizations prioritize digital protection against sophisticated threats, driving interest in short, skills-focused bootcamps. These programs offer hands-on labs, simulated attacks, and industry certifications that are immediately relevant for security roles, shortening time-to-hire. Furthermore, high wage premiums, persistent talent shortages, and regulatory compliance requirements across sectors increase employer demand for vetted practitioners. Bootcamps can iterate curricula to reflect evolving threat landscapes, making them attractive training pipelines. As a result, cybersecurity courses are forecast to expand faster than other specializations.
During the forecast period, the North America region is expected to hold the largest market share because of a mature technology ecosystem, concentrated demand for developer talent, and a supportive funding environment for education startups. Large employers in the United States and Canada actively recruit bootcamp graduates, producing reliable placement outcomes that attract students. Robust venture capital, strong industry partnerships, and widespread broadband access allow providers to scale platforms. Cultural acceptance of nontraditional credentials, frequent tech hiring cycles, and career services sustain higher enrollment and revenue, securing North America's largest market share consistently.
Over the forecast period, the Asia Pacific region is anticipated to exhibit the highest CAGR driven by rapid digitalization, emerging talent pools, and adoption of upskilling initiatives across enterprises. Growing internet penetration and mobile-first learning habits lower barriers for virtual programs, while governments and corporations invest in workforce digital skills. Additionally, cost-sensitive learners favor shorter, affordable bootcamps over lengthy degrees, and a burgeoning startup ecosystem creates demand for practical developer expertise. Localized content, flexible schedules and expanding payment options further accelerate market uptake across diverse APAC markets.
Key players in the market
Some of the key players in Online Coding Bootcamps Market include General Assembly, Flatiron School, Le Wagon, Ironhack, App Academy, Coding Dojo, Springboard, Thinkful, Microverse, BrainStation, Holberton School, Bloom Institute of Technology, Fullstack Academy, Nucamp, CareerFoundry, and Hack Reactor.
In July 2025, Flatiron School launched accelerated fully online tech bootcamps in partnership with the School of Professional & Continuing Studies starting September 2025. Offers flexible, hands-on courses with career services and a network of major tech employer partners.
